Obituary: Raymond Varner, Sr.

Raymond Robert Varner, Sr., age 93 of Rhinelander, died Monday, Sept. 28, 2020 at Ascension St. Mary’s Hospital.  He was born March 10, 1927, in Bessemer, Mich. to Julius and Elsie Varner. As a young man, Ray enlisted in the Navy and served aboard the U.S.S. Massachusettes as a gunner mate during WWII.

Ray is survived by his daughter, Diana Wolfson (Robert) of Naperville, Ill.; two grandsons; four great-grandchildren; brother, James M. Varner (Merle) of Brooksville, Fla.; longtime companion and caregiver, Joan Schlieve of Rhinelander; two nieces; and many friends.

He was preceded in death by his sisters, Winona Henig (AJ) and Dorothy E. Hershman (Ramon); his brother Willard D. Varner (Janet); his first wife, Ruth Webb Becker (Gale) and his son, Raymond Robert Varner, Jr. (U.S. Marine Corps – Vietnam).

Visitation will take place 3-4 p.m., Saturday, Oct. 10 at Carlson Funeral Home. There will be a private family service led by Pastor Mike Adams of Lakeland Living Water Church. Ray will be laid to rest at the Rock Island National Cemetery where his son, Raymond Varner, Jr., is buried. (Carlson Funeral Home)
